Cant get carb off

OK... really dumb question, but how do you get the carb off of an 84' s10? I can't get in there with any sized wrench or socket or even with the tool specially designed for this problem. The carb absolutely blocks the bolts from top to bottom and from 3 sides.

If it's the 2.8L it's a really tight fit.

What I did was use a 1/4" drive flex shaft extension on my rachet, with a short socket.
It worked nicely
I also found it easier stand on a 1' high bench and to remove the egr valve.

I don't think that you'd have the room for a crowfoot wrench in there, but since I don't own any I really can't say that I tried
